Pricing experiment for the Seatlark checkout, variant B. Applies dynamic discount on off-peak shows only. Guardrails: floor price enforced server-side, experiment auto-disables if refund rate crosses threshold. Do not ship without the kill switch wired to the flag service. Values reviewed with finance at the Bramwick sync; adjust only via a tagged release. Experiment constants follow.

tuning constants:
QUOTAS = {
    "druwyn": 5,
    "holix": 5,
    "zorath": 5,
    "holwyn": 10,
}

From Director Maelis Trent to Director Oskar Vane. The Bridgefern reseller scheme now covers 43 partners; top five generate 61% of channel revenue. Tier criteria were revised in June; two partners in the Calloway district remain on probation for margin leakage. Renewal contracts for the Hartwell cohort are queued for your signature. Rebate accruals are current through last quarter. Outstanding item: the Northgale exclusivity request, unresolved. For the board's benefit, the forward plan for the programme is appended below.

confidential, kagep-kahof: Druokax Systems plans to lower the Ulaath list price by 53 percent in March.

Ticket: Schema registry config drift between staging and prod

Heads up, future maintainers: the Cobblenook event schema registry in staging has drifted from prod — compatibility mode and retention differ, which is why staging accepts payloads prod rejects. Please treat prod as the source of truth and re-sync staging. For reference, the canonical registry configuration is as follows.

settings of tagef-bawif:
DRUIX_HOST=druix.zemvarlabs.internal
DRUIX_PORT=8000

- [ ] Pre-ceremony: freeze the Cartwheel checkout load tests. No synthetic traffic while signing keys rotate — last time a load run hit the staging HSM and skewed results. Confirm the load rig is paused, log the timestamp, then open the ceremony locker. The locker accepts only the recovery passphrase written directly below this line.

unlock words, hahip-baduf: holwyn-istath-julvan